As a Project Manager, you will be responsible for the most major, politically sensitive, complex initiatives in the National Capital Region. This position is located in the National Capital Region, Public Building Service, White House Service Center in Washington, DC. The White House Service Center provides facilities management and supply services support to the White House.

Category rating will be used to rank candidates into one of the three Quality groups; Best Qualified, Well Qualified, and Qualified. Veteran’s preference consideration, if supported by appropriate documentation, is then applied. Qualified preference eligibles are placed above non-preference eligibles within their respective quality category and considered before non-preference-eligibles in that category.
